Pros

The pay was good, decent other customer assistants, the interview process was also easy and well run. The staff discount is also a real bonus and saves you a lot of money.

Cons

Management was both useless and rude. The company also shows no respect for its staff. Procedures not followed such as those for training. Breaks not always given. Sometimes sat on a till for 9 hours at a time, it drives you insane.
